Merge pull request #116070 from aramase/aramase/f/kms-pkg/util

[KMS] move util from envelope to kms package
This commit is contained in:
Kubernetes Prow Robot 2023-02-26 19:52:18 -08:00 committed by GitHub
commit 0e077bb7ac
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
5 changed files with 4 additions and 4 deletions

View File

@ -28,9 +28,9 @@ import (
"google.golang.org/grpc/credentials/insecure" "google.golang.org/grpc/credentials/insecure"
utilruntime "k8s.io/apimachinery/pkg/util/runtime" utilruntime "k8s.io/apimachinery/pkg/util/runtime"
"k8s.io/apiserver/pkg/storage/value/encrypt/envelope/util"
"k8s.io/klog/v2" "k8s.io/klog/v2"
kmsapi "k8s.io/kms/apis/v1beta1" kmsapi "k8s.io/kms/apis/v1beta1"
"k8s.io/kms/pkg/util"
) )
const ( const (

View File

@ -28,10 +28,10 @@ import (
utilruntime "k8s.io/apimachinery/pkg/util/runtime" utilruntime "k8s.io/apimachinery/pkg/util/runtime"
"k8s.io/apiserver/pkg/storage/value/encrypt/envelope/metrics" "k8s.io/apiserver/pkg/storage/value/encrypt/envelope/metrics"
"k8s.io/apiserver/pkg/storage/value/encrypt/envelope/util"
"k8s.io/klog/v2" "k8s.io/klog/v2"
kmsapi "k8s.io/kms/apis/v2alpha1" kmsapi "k8s.io/kms/apis/v2alpha1"
kmsservice "k8s.io/kms/pkg/service" kmsservice "k8s.io/kms/pkg/service"
"k8s.io/kms/pkg/util"
) )
const ( const (

View File

@ -27,7 +27,7 @@ const (
unixProtocol = "unix" unixProtocol = "unix"
) )
// Parse the endpoint to extract schema, host or path. // ParseEndpoint parses the endpoint to extract schema, host or path.
func ParseEndpoint(endpoint string) (string, error) { func ParseEndpoint(endpoint string) (string, error) {
if len(endpoint) == 0 { if len(endpoint) == 0 {
return "", fmt.Errorf("remote KMS provider can't use empty string as endpoint") return "", fmt.Errorf("remote KMS provider can't use empty string as endpoint")

2
vendor/modules.txt vendored
View File

@ -1577,7 +1577,6 @@ k8s.io/apiserver/pkg/storage/value/encrypt/envelope/kmsv2/v2alpha1
k8s.io/apiserver/pkg/storage/value/encrypt/envelope/metrics k8s.io/apiserver/pkg/storage/value/encrypt/envelope/metrics
k8s.io/apiserver/pkg/storage/value/encrypt/envelope/testing/v1beta1 k8s.io/apiserver/pkg/storage/value/encrypt/envelope/testing/v1beta1
k8s.io/apiserver/pkg/storage/value/encrypt/envelope/testing/v2alpha1 k8s.io/apiserver/pkg/storage/value/encrypt/envelope/testing/v2alpha1
k8s.io/apiserver/pkg/storage/value/encrypt/envelope/util
k8s.io/apiserver/pkg/storage/value/encrypt/identity k8s.io/apiserver/pkg/storage/value/encrypt/identity
k8s.io/apiserver/pkg/storage/value/encrypt/secretbox k8s.io/apiserver/pkg/storage/value/encrypt/secretbox
k8s.io/apiserver/pkg/storageversion k8s.io/apiserver/pkg/storageversion
@ -2108,6 +2107,7 @@ k8s.io/klog/v2/test
k8s.io/kms/apis/v1beta1 k8s.io/kms/apis/v1beta1
k8s.io/kms/apis/v2alpha1 k8s.io/kms/apis/v2alpha1
k8s.io/kms/pkg/service k8s.io/kms/pkg/service
k8s.io/kms/pkg/util
# k8s.io/kube-aggregator v0.0.0 => ./staging/src/k8s.io/kube-aggregator # k8s.io/kube-aggregator v0.0.0 => ./staging/src/k8s.io/kube-aggregator
## explicit; go 1.19 ## explicit; go 1.19
k8s.io/kube-aggregator/pkg/apis/apiregistration k8s.io/kube-aggregator/pkg/apis/apiregistration